Why Start with 2.5 mg?
Usually, doctors start with a low dose for every patient. Some people are sensitive to hormonal drugs and their bodies do not accept which can pose serious side effects. So, a low dose is appropriate in the initial phase.
The 2.5 mg start is not chosen randomly, but it helps your body adjust to the medication, reduces gastrointestinal side effects like nausea and diarrhea, and sets the stage for a gradual dose increase.
Most patients will start with 2.5 mg weekly treatment for the first four weeks. This is known as the initial titration phase, and it gives your body time to get used to the hormonal effects. It regulates blood sugar levels and suppresses appetite.
Titration Schedule: How Dosage Progresses Over Time
After the first month, patients enter a titration schedule to gradually increase the dose. This gradual increase helps balance efficacy and tolerability.
Here, we have a usual titration schedule followed for oral tirzepatide liquid drops. It will let you know about the regular dose and the increment of the dosage. Here it is:
Week | Recommended Dose |
---|---|
Weeks 1–4 | 2.5 mg once weekly |
Weeks 5–8 | 5 mg once weekly |
Weeks 9–12 | 7.5 mg once weekly (if tolerated) |
Weeks 13+ | 10 mg or higher, depending on goals and tolerance |
The above dose varies person to person, so everyone cannot follow this chart. That is why you should take exact recommendation from your consultant.
Some points to note:
- These doses are administered just like the injectable formulations, once a week.
- There is a possibility of some doctors keeping the patients on a lower dose longer when side effects show up.
- The oral Tirzepatide liquid drops' dose is usually maximized depending on the personal need and response.
Why a Weekly Treatment Schedule?
Usually, doctors recommend oral and injectable weight-lowering drugs once a week. The mechanism of Tirzepatide is constant incretin stimulation; thus, a once-weekly use helps maintain the therapeutic levels in your body.
It can be either an injection or oral tirzepatide because thier aims are same. Both control appetite and enhance insulin sesitivrtu during the week. Missing doses, taking twice a dose or even interchanging between formulations sometimes without medical involvement increases side effects or decreases the effectiveness.

What If You Miss a Dose?
Forget to take oral liquid tirzepatide drops this week? Do not worry, skipping your weekly therapy is not the end of the world. However, what you should do after that matters.
We have some tips to remember if you miss a dose:
- In case you remember about it within 4 days, you should take a dose as soon as possible.
- In case there have been over 4 days since the last dose, skip that dose and come back to the schedule.
- Do not duplicate the next dose.
You should always consult your doctor or nutritionist to get specific instructions because it may vary from person to person.
